Machine Learning Algorithm Developer

Published date Posted on Indeed on Oct 05, 2021 (20 d ago)


Founded in 2017, Activ Surgical is a first-of-its kind digital surgery company focused on improving surgical efficiency, accuracy, patient outcomes and accessibility for both endoscopic and robotically assisted procedures. Activ Surgical’s scalable and patent-protected surgical software platform technology is driven by computer vision, artificial intelligence, analytics, and machine learning to enhance a surgeon’s intra-operative decision making and reduce unintended and preventable surgical complications.

Activ Surgical is looking for individuals who are interested in shaping the future of healthcare by improving patient outcomes, reducing healthcare costs, and addressing unintended surgical complications.


You will join a team where everyone—including you—is striving to constantly create innovative technology. We are an incredibly supportive team–we love to pitch in when problems arise and give great peer feedback to help each other grow. We are passionate about lots of things—artificial intelligence, machine learning, autonomous robotics and a great user experience-and we love sharing those passions with each other.


Fortune 500 Health & Wellness


Flexible Vacation


In our growing engineering department, you will be working on medical device software development. This includes tasks such as developing, prototyping, implementing, and evaluating real-time techniques for object detection, segmentation, identification, and tracking. You will apply existing knowledge of image and video processing, machine learning and deep learning to medical data and play an integral part in developing strategies for long-term cloud-based data collection and analysis. You must be able to effectively communicate ideas and collaborate closely with a cross-functional team to achieve goals.


  • BS / MS in Computer Science, Computer Engineering, Electrical Engineering, or related field with a strong focus on real-time image and video processing
  • Rapid ability to conceptualize and design complex software, including ability to quickly prototype proof of concept software in Python
  • Experience in high-performance scientific computing, parallel programming, and multi-threading
  • Familiarity with deep learning frameworks, such as PyTorch or TensorFlow
  • Ability to thrive in a fast-paced startup environment


  • Experience with applying machine learning/deep learning strategies and probabilistic/statistical models to medical image processing and analysis
  • Experience implementing cloud-based data storage and machine learning software
  • Experience with OpenCV
  • Expertise in C/C++
  • Prior experience working in the medical device industry

Let us know

Help us maintain the quality of jobs posted on RemoteTechJobs and let us know if:

Error on reporting

Related jobs

4 d ago

Open Source is in our genes. Open means more than shared source code to us. It’s a philosophy and approach ingrained in everything we do. It’s how we develop software, how we work with partners and customers, and how we engage with communities. Most of all, it’s

Relative Dynamics Relative Dynamics |

Relative Dynamics Inc. is looking for a FPGA Engineer, who will work on the Advanced Development Group in our Greenbelt, MD HQ office. This position requires a background in digital signal processing (DSP) and communication theory. This engineer is responsible for the architectur

DeepSight Technology DeepSight Technology |

DeepSight Technology Inc. of St. Louis, MO is seeking to hire a full-time Software Engineer/ Imaging to join our medical imaging technology team. This position earns a competitive salary, depending on experience, as well as generous benefits, including health, vision, dental, sto

The Senior Software Engineer will help us to create tools for the latest and greatest movie production and in-camera VFX. We are currently looking for someone who is going to help us in creating software that is maintainable, extensible, and who can teach the team on how to build

Interested in joining the industry leader in pavement marking controls check out our website: www.skip-line.comOverview:The Embedded Software Engineer, Sensor Integration role is critical for continued company growth at Skip-Line. This position will define, build, implement, and.

Solve complicated static timing modeling problems while working on the interface between the Vivado software and the FPGA hardware. Write code to automate static timing path modeling and timing path binning; and debug issues between the hardware design and the software model.Skil